Pop the Balloon Live Episode 4: Where Are the Contestants Now?

Netflix’s ‘Pop the Balloon Live’ is a reality dating experiment wherein a blend of public personalities and everyday singles agree to open up in front of the world to test their chemistry in real time. Based on the YouTube series of the same name by Arlette Amuli, it essentially highlights the ways of the world of modern dating by placing emphasis on ambitions, aesthetics, and assumptions. Therefore, romance, drama, as well as icks between the lineup and daters are at the forefront of this original production, and episode 4, aptly titled ‘Big Pop Energy,’ is absolutely no different.

Drew Carrick is a Certified Public Accountant Who Also Raps

It was back when Drew Carrick was pursuing his Bachelor’s in Accounting at Mount St. Mary’s University (2010-2013) that he kickstarted his career. After years of doing odd jobs like refereeing Grade 8 soccer matches in his hometown of Long Island or serving as a Lifeguard at the West Oak Recreation Club, he became an Audit Intern at Grant Thornton in 2012. Upon graduation, he became a Graduate Assistant at his university for over a year, that is, until he decided to take a leap of faith and embrace different opportunities with open arms. Drew evolved into a Content Developer and Finance Director at Apex Evolution Media & Ready Set Studios in August 2014, only to soon decide to spread his wings. While working here (until December 2014), he also took up a few other jobs, including as a Chief Editor/Creator at CPA Hacks from May 2015 to May 2016, and various positions at Grant Thornton, where he did his internship.

Drew started as an Audit Associate in December 2014 before being promoted to Audit Senior Associate in August 2016, and from there, he worked as a Senior Consultant from 2017 to February 2018. Since then, Drew has earned his MBA, served as the Associate Vice President – Budget Director at Long Island University, co-founded a company called Evolve Now, and worked as the Director of Strategic Planning at FloQast. Today, though, the Certified Public Accountant (CPA) is a freelance professional, a rapper, an actor, and an influencer who seems to be doing great things. Whenever he is not working, the history buff can be found at Civil War reenactments and fairs or embracing his passion for entertainment and comedy. So, he presently splits his time between New York and Los Angeles.

Devin Duggan is a Man of Many Hats

While it’s true that Devin Duggan currently resides in Tampa, Florida, and serves as the Head of Sales of a local brokerage, the truth is he is also so much more. The Bethlehem, Pennsylvania, native is a former professional football player who even had a stint in the NFL, that is, until he sadly incurred a career-ending injury. After that, he decided to get into the world of sales and even dabbled in business, all the while embracing opportunities to be a part of reality television. Apart from ‘Pop the Balloon Live,’ he can be seen on ‘Married by Mom and Dad’ season 2, ‘Ready to Love,’ and ‘5 Guys in a Week.’

Since then, though, Devin has evolved into a full-fledged businessman by becoming part-owner of a solar company called Achieve Solar, serving as a National Account Executive at Progressive Freight, and getting into real estate. As if that’s not enough, he has continued being an active part of the entertainment industry, and today, he has even evolved into Modeling and is signed under the talent agencies Professionally Pretty and Level Talent Group. In 2024, he even walked the runway of Miami Swim Week. However, since becoming a single father, he has been focusing more on spending quality time with his family, too, indicating he has a great work-life balance at the moment.

Lorenzo Meynardi is a Dedicated Artist and Producer

Although born and brought up in Rome, Italy, Lorenzo reportedly knew from an early age that he wanted to be a part of the music world, driving him to relocate to Los Angeles, California, for good when he was in his early 20s. Since then, he has not only graduated from the Berklee College of Music but also established an incredible career for himself as a musician as well as a businessman. After all, he is not only a drummer who has quite a unique sound (Funk-Rock fusion), but he is also the brains behind Black Lotus Studios. His artist name is actually Stif-Lo MCD, and he started this business alongside AM Dandy and Guney Tamer (aka Southesizer). As if that’s not enough, it is also imperative to note that he is currently a member of the band THUNDERPETZ and the female-fronted hard-rock group Band Inc. He is also associated with PastAtaly, a food truck on the streets of Los Angeles, California.

Griffin Scillian is a Creative Being in Every Sense

A native of Detroit, Michigan, Griffin Scillian was just a teenager when he kickstarted his career in 2008 while attending Wayne State University as an English major. His first job was actually as a Writer, Assistant Editor, and Ad Director at the local 944 Magazine, where he served for a year before focusing on his studies and spreading his wings. Therefore, his next stable job wasn’t until 2014 when he joined Zara Creative as a Director, Producer, Writer, and Voice Actor, only to serve there for just a year prior to moving on.

Griffin’s next stint was at Doner as a Broadcast Producer for 2 years, from where he went to Unrealistic Ideas to serve as an Associate Producer for a year before being promoted to Development Coordinator. However, in 2019, he quit his job to become his own boss, meaning he became the Founder and Executive Producer at Trouble In Paradise, an independent film and television production company. As if that’s not enough, we should mention Griffin is also a professional photographer, all the while building strong relationships and pitching original, hopefully timeless projects to various online streaming platforms and cable networks.

Eliott Nazarian Effortlessly Balances Law and Entertainment

If there’s one thing absolutely no one can deny, it’s that Eliott Nazarian is the personification of charm. However, he is also incredibly smart. He actually earned a Bachelor’s in Philosophy and Spanish from Vanderbilt University in 2016, only to then attend the Sandra Day O’Connor College of Law at Arizona State University for his Juris Doctorate. Therefore, he kickstarted his career in 2019 as a Legal Intern at the White House Office of Science and Technology Policy and then at the Executive Office for Immigration Review at the US Department of Justice. From there, he actually stepped into the offices of the US Department of State, where he intervened in the departments of the Bureau of Near Eastern Affairs, the Executive Office, and the Office of Iranian Affairs, to then take on the role of Attorney Advisor.

In September 2022, though, Eliott decided to shift gears and move into private law. He became an Immigration Attorney at The Matian Firm, shortly following which, in 2024, he launched his own law firm. So, today, at the age of 31, he is a Managing Attorney at Nazarian Law Firm near the heart of Los Angeles, California, all the while also dabbling in entertainment. According to records, Eliott has always had a passion for being in front of the cameras and being a comic, so he knew it was high time to pursue this path once the global pandemic hit. Since then, the travel enthusiast has been a part of this aforementioned Netflix show, ‘Doctor Odyssey’ (in 2024), ‘Swiped and Arman’ (2025), and much more.
